中文摘要: |
一种兼备组织等效性好、灵敏度高的新型热释光材料——LiF(Mg,Cu,P)已用国产原料在实验室中制备出来。本文报道了这种热释光材料作成的热释光剂量计的主要特性,并与几种常用的热释光剂量计作了比较。实验表明。LjF(Mg,Cu,P)的灵敏度约为美国Hatshaw公司生产的LiF—TLD100的30倍,在0.3毫伦~1000伦范围内有良好线性;受照后元件在室温条件下保存两个月,热释光衰退小于5%;对30keVX线的响应为对60Co γ线响应的1.26倍。近一年来的性能实验和初步应用说明,这是一种很有前途的热释光剂量计。 |
英文摘要: |
A New highly sensitive LiF(Mg,Cu,P)has been made in our laboratory.Its dosimetric properties have been studied.The main results obtained in this experiment are as follows:The sensitivity of new highly sensitive LiF TLD is about 30 times higher than that of Harshaw LiF TLD-100。And nearly equal to that of CaSO4(TLD;the thermoluminescence response to the exposure increases linearly in the range of the exposure from 0.3 mR to 1000R;the energy dependence of LiF(Mg,CU, P)TLD is so small that its response at 30 keV is 1.26 times as large as that to 60Co gamma radiation;its fading approximates to 5% at room temperature during two months. |
